Mission
The mission of the Portland Public Schools is to ensure a challenging, relevant, and joyful education that empowers every learner to make a difference in the world. We build relationships among families, educators, and the community to promote the healthy development and academic achievement of every learner.
ObjectivesThe Ameri Corps VISTA member’s service is driven by our organization’s mission to ensure equal access to educational opportunities that address poverty in our community. We will support language minority students in their post‑secondary aspirations and guide them through that process during their secondary career. We will engage parents and community members from underrepresented groups through volunteerism and participation in workshop sessions for parents and community partners on issues related to raising children in today’s world.
We will partner with community‑based organizations in bringing their programs to expand learning opportunities for both students and parents. This is a full‑time, in‑person role.
- Organize and coordinate events and activities for fundraising, parent engagement, and community outreach, including Parent University lecture series, bi‑annual Beyond Borders conference, and annual spring fundraiser.
- Assist on event related marketing and communication activities.
- Solicit donors and sponsors for department events and activities.
- Seek community‑based organizations that can become partners in delivering our program of activities.
- Plan Parent University event series for family engagement.
- Assist in planning other multilingual events such as the Back to School Fair, Make it Happen Senior Celebration, and others.
- Contribute to problem solving and strategy by thinking through complex circumstances and assisting stakeholders in finding inclusive solutions.
- Stipend of $957.46 bi‑weekly throughout the 12‑month term.
- Choice of $7,395.00 education award or cash stipend upon completion of service.
- Education award can be used to pay off qualified loans or for educational expenses.
- Forbearance of federally qualified student loans during service term (interest paid).
- Healthcare benefits.
- 20 days of sick and vacation leave.
